2015-03-03 23 views
0

Я хочу назвать несколько ниже в формате с использованием platformRequest:Вызов номера со специальными символами в J2ME Nokia

platformRequest("tel:number,number#number#"); 

Но я получаю неверный номер ошибки, можно ли это сделать?

+0

Что это за номер? Я думаю, если вы ищете небольшую паузу, вы можете получить ее, вставив «p». Вполне возможно, что пауза представлена ​​запятой в телефонной книге, но я думаю, что 'platformRequest()' хочет вместо этого «p». –

+0

Что-то вроде этого: 080099330,7495692664036 # 0096255455 # – Reham

+0

И что произойдет, если вы замените запятую на «p»? –

ответ

1

Я просто отправлю свой комментарий в качестве ответа здесь, так что вы можете отметить вопрос как ответ.

Вы получаете недопустимую цифровую ошибку, поскольку в телефоне нет запятой. При просмотре вашей адресной книги может быть запятая в виде визуального представления паузы в номере. Но при использовании platformRequest("tel:<number>); вы должны использовать символ «p», чтобы получить паузу.

Итак, в телефонной книжке необходимо ввести номер 080099330,7495692664036#0096255455#, как platformRequest("tel:080099330p7495692664036#0096255455#"); Другими словами, запятая заменяется на p.